1. Watering is recommendedIt is best to water the Kusanagi plant once after it has just been repotted to help its roots integrate more closely with the new soil. In addition, if the new soil does not have a certain amount of moisture, it may cause various growth problems due to lack of water. However, not all cases require watering after repotting. 2. No watering1. Root damage: If the root system is damaged due to improper operation when repotting, it is not advisable to water it immediately. 2. Replace moist soil: If the new potting soil itself has a certain humidity, then there is no need for additional watering. |
